Why Slow Travel is the Ultimate European Luxury
In our hyper-connected world, the old way of vacationing is exhausting. Racing through three countries in seven days to snap a photo in front of a monument leaves you needing a vacation from your vacation.
​
As a luxury travel advisor, I see a profound shift in how my clients want to experience Europe. They are trading the frantic checklist for a deeper rhythm. This is the essence of slow travel. It means staying in one place longer, unpacking once, and trading tourist traps for authentic cultural immersion.
What is Slow Travel?
Slow travel is a mindset shift. It prioritizes the quality of your experiences over the quantity of your destinations. Instead of rushing to tick a box, slow travel invites you to become part of a destination's daily life.
  • Deep connection: Spending meaningful time in one region.
  • Cultural immersion: Engaging with local artisans, historians, and chefs.
  • Rhythms over routines: Letting the day unfold naturally without a rigid schedule.
  • Sustainability: Supporting small, independent local businesses.
River Cruising: The Ultimate Vessel for Slow Travel
Many people associate cruising with massive ocean liners and crowded ports. European river cruising is entirely different. It is arguably the most elegant manifestation of the slow travel philosophy.
A riverboat functions as your boutique floating hotel. It glides directly into the historic heart of Europe's greatest cities and hidden villages.

Unpack Just Once
The logistical friction of travel vanishes. You do not waste half-days packing, checking out of hotels, hauling luggage to train stations, and waiting in airport lines. Your energy is preserved entirely for exploration.

A Front-Row Seat to Changing Scenery
On a river cruise, the journey itself is the destination. You can sit on your private balcony with a glass of local Riesling, watching centuries-old castles, terraced vineyards, and medieval villages drift by at a peaceful 10 miles per hour.

Curated, Small-Group Experiences
Instead of generic bus tours, luxury river lines prioritize exclusive access. You might enjoy a private, early-morning walk through Monet’s gardens in Giverny before the gates open to the public, or attend an exclusive classical concert in a Viennese palace.
Crafting Your Custom European Extension
True luxury lies in personalization. The most seamless way to embrace slow travel is to pair a meticulously selected river cruise with a custom-designed land extension.
Imagine wrapping up a culinary cruise down the Rhône River through Provence, but instead of rushing to the airport, you transition to a private villa in the French countryside for another week.

As your advisor, I handle the intricate puzzle of this transition:
  • Geographic continuity: Selecting boutique hotels that complement the spirit of your cruise.
  • Seamless logistics: Arranging private drivers to transfer you effortlessly from the ship to your next destination.
  • Vetted local experts: Connecting you with private guides who can show you the neighborhood secrets only locals know.You get a cohesive, four-week European summer journey without a single logistical headache.
